Output 51ef60e1a40ea102e137ceeea3275275cc3d2c8eabb5caa01007eaa92d55d12d:1
- value
- 2349656
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 384ce65aed9edba5ce33c71d1b01f8e63d34d2f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 168gxqVLyyYSgxU2pxvbBeXGK3b8JwDoMU
- transaction
- 51ef60e1a40ea102e137ceeea3275275cc3d2c8eabb5caa01007eaa92d55d12d
- confirmations
- 129372
- spent
- true